You know, China's been really stepping up its game when it comes to battery bank technology lately. They've set some pretty high quality standards that are shaking up the global market. A report from the International Energy Agency (IEA) revealed that in 2022, a whopping 75% of all battery production came from China! Talk about dominance in this field! This amazing growth is fueled by some serious cash being put into research and development, which is leading to battery banks that are not just more efficient but also tougher and longer-lasting.
And get this: the introduction of ultra-fast charging and longer lifespans in these battery banks are really raising the bar for quality everywhere. According to a study by BloombergNEF, the cost of lithium-ion batteries has plummeted by 89% since 2010, largely because of the cool innovations coming from Chinese tech companies. These advancements aren’t just boosting performance, they’re also pressuring competitors from around the globe to step it up as well. Plus, as Chinese manufacturers are putting more emphasis on sustainability and working to lower their carbon footprints, they’re not just changing their local markets; they’re also setting new quality standards internationally.

You know, the explosion in popularity of Chinese battery banks really comes down to a few key factors—namely, tech advancements, competitive pricing, and a solid understanding of what consumers want. The International Energy Agency (IEA) is saying that the global appetite for portable power sources has really ramped up lately, with an expected growth rate of around 20% each year until 2025. Chinese companies have jumped on this trend, cranking out high-capacity power banks that charge super fast and meet all the necessary safety and efficiency standards. MarketsandMarkets even reported that by 2027, the global power bank market could hit $25 billion, with a hefty chunk coming from innovative stuff coming out of China.
What’s also interesting is how consumer preferences really shape this whole landscape. A survey from Statista found that about 67% of people care most about charging speed and capacity when picking out a power bank. Brands like Anker and Xiaomi are totally onto this—they’ve packed in advanced lithium-ion tech and smart charging features to make life easier for users. Plus, with prices often as much as 30% lower than their Western rivals, these products are super attractive for folks on a budget. So, it’s no wonder that Chinese battery banks are not just taking over local markets, but they’re also raising the bar for quality on a global scale.
